"Also at the top of the list was my three day appearance on 'Press Your Luck'. In addition to the intense competition of each of those games, it slowly started to dawn on me in the minutes between tapings that I was winning some serious money"
About this Quote
As an entertainer, West knows how to pace a reveal. He foregrounds “intense competition,” borrowing the language of athletic grit to dignify what is, on paper, a brightly lit gimmick. Then he shifts to the in-between, the minutes “between tapings,” where the show stops being performance and becomes accounting. The subtext is that the most consequential part of the spectacle happens off-camera, in the quiet air of the studio when your nervous system finally has time to process what your smile has been faking.
The intent reads as both confession and flex: a “top of the list” memory framed as personal highlight, but narrated with enough humility to keep it likable. Contextually, Press Your Luck sits in that 80s ecosystem where ordinary people briefly touched absurd sums under hot lights, a culture pre-Internet that still believed luck could be televised and clean. West captures the strange whiplash of being a participant in entertainment and, suddenly, its beneficiary.
